Abstract

The utility model relates to the technical field of tents and discloses a high-stability tent which comprises a tent body, wherein a through groove is formed in the front face of the tent body. According to the tent, the positioning rod, the square plate, the limiting block and the fixing plate are arranged, when the tent is used, the limiting block prevents the round block from sliding down from the round groove, the tent body is enabled to be in a vertical state all the time, the positioning rod is used for supporting the square plate, the tent body is supported through the square plate, the positioning rod is connected through the inclined rod on the positioning rod, the positioning rod is enabled to be more stable, the tent body is supported through the positioning rod and the square plate, the tent body is enabled to be more stable, the problem that in the prior art, the existing common tent is used, the fixing mode of the existing tent is simple, the stability of the tent is low, the tent can be inclined or even toppled over in a severe environment is solved effectively, and the effect of improving the stability is achieved.

Description

High stability tent
Technical Field
The utility model relates to the technical field of tents, in particular to a high-stability tent.
Background
Travel is increasingly becoming a part of modern people's family life, and open-air camping is one of the mode of travelling and going out, and open-air camping needs to prepare many living goods that the field survived needs, and the tent is just one of them, and the tent can provide the space of a rest for people, can also play the effect of preventing weather transformation and preventing the beast from assaulting.
Among the prior art, common tent is in the use at present, current tent support mainly includes the roof-rack on upper portion and four spinal branchs framves that the below is used for supporting, and fixed connection between only upper end of support and the roof-rack, the fixed structure of tent is comparatively simple, the stability that leads to the tent is lower, in comparatively abominable environment, the condition that the tent can appear crooked or even topple over, simultaneously, most tents generally all directly lay subaerial, ground is comparatively moist, lead to sultry moist in the tent, thereby user's travelling comfort has been reduced.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-5, a high stability tent comprises a tent body 1, a through groove 2 is formed in the front of the tent body 1, a turning plate 3 is fixedly connected to the front of the tent body 1 through a hinge, the side surface of the turning plate 3 is slidably connected to the inner wall of the through groove 2, a handle 4 is fixedly connected to the front of the turning plate 3, a square groove 5 is formed in the back of the tent body 1, a fixing plate 6 is fixedly connected to the bottom of the tent body 1, a fixing block 7 is fixedly connected to the bottom of the fixing plate 6, a positioning device 8 is arranged inside the fixing block 7, a round block 9 is fixedly connected to the top of the tent body 1, a square plate 10 is arranged above the tent body 1, the top of the tent body 1 is overlapped with the lower surface of the square plate 10, a round groove 11 is formed in the upper surface of the square plate 10, the inner wall of the round groove 11 is slidably connected to the surface of the round block 9, and a positioning rod 12 is fixedly connected to the lower surface of the square plate 10, the positioning device 8 comprises a positioning groove 801, a hydraulic rod 802 and barbs 803, the positioning groove 801 is arranged at the bottom of the fixing block 7, the hydraulic rod 802 is fixed at the top of the inner wall of the positioning groove 801, the barbs 803 are fixed on the surface of the hydraulic rod 802, the hydraulic rod 802 is used as power to push the barbs 803 into the ground, the positioning groove 801 is used for placing the hydraulic rod 802 and the barbs 803, one end of the round block 9 is sleeved with a limiting block 13, the limiting block 13 is positioned above the square plate 10, the limiting block 13 is fixed on the round block 9, the limiting block 13 prevents the round block 9 from sliding off from the round groove 11, the inner wall of the square groove 5 is fixedly connected with a filter screen 14, the square groove 5 is square, the filter screen 14 is matched with the square groove 5, the filter screen 14 is fixed in the square groove 5, the filter screen 14 prevents external dust and sundries from entering the tent body 1, the two positioning rods 12 on both sides of the tent body 1 are respectively, an inclined rod 15 is fixedly connected between the two positioning rods 12, the connecting rod 12 is connected to the down tube 15, makes the more firm of locating rod 12, and the quantity of fixed block 7 is four, and four two liang are a set of fixed block 7, and two sets of fixed blocks 7 are symmetrical setting for the plane of symmetry about the vertical face in center of fixed plate 6, and four fixed blocks 7 carry out stable support to the tent body 1 of fixed plate 6 top, prevent that tent body 1 from taking place to rock.
Working principle, when in use, after the tent body 1 is built, the fixing plate 6 is fixed at the bottom of the tent body 1, after the fixing plate is fixed, the fixing block 7 can be contacted with the ground, the positioning rod 12 is fixed on the ground, after the fixing, the hydraulic rod 802 is opened, the hydraulic rod 802 drives the barb 803 to be inserted into the ground, after the barb 803 is inserted to a proper depth, the hydraulic rod 802 is closed, the fixing block 7 can be firmly fixed, the round block 9 on the tent body 1 passes through the round groove 11, the limiting block 13 is sleeved at one end of the round block 9, the limiting block 13 is attached to the upper surface of the square plate 10, after the attachment, the handle 4 is held, the turning plate 3 is opened, the turning plate 3 rotates by taking the hinge as a circle center, after the turning plate 3 is opened, a user can enter the tent body 1, if the tent body 1 needs to be detached, the limiting block 13 is taken down, the round block 9 slides down along the inner wall of the round groove 11, the hydraulic rod 802 is opened, the hydraulic rod 802 drives the barb 803 to separate from the ground, and after the barb 803 is separated, the fixing plate 6 is detached, and after the fixing plate is detached, the tent body 1 can be used.
